James B. “Jim” Shackelford, 84, of Olmstead passed away Sunday, Aug. 2, 2020 at Creekwood Nursing and Rehab in Russellville. He was born in Knoxville on March 12, 1936 to the late A. A. Shackelford and Gladys Randles Shackelford.

He was a member of Dripping Spring Baptist Church where he was saved and baptized in 1948. He farmed most of his life; he also worked as a stone mason. He worked for the Logan County Sheriff’s Department and was a Logan County Detective, was one of the founders of the Logan County CD Rescue unit and served 24 years. He also did custom spraying for 23 years, was a Shriner and served in the Army National Guard.

Along with his parents, he was preceded in death by his wife, Mary Ellen Shackelford; his brother, Charles Shackelford; his sisters, Ruby Steward, Margaret Proctor, Wanda Mason, Mildred Curtis and Betty Jean Shackelford. 

He is survived by his son, Timmy Shackelford and wife Susan of Bowling Green; his daughters, Ellen Neal and Tammy Pedigo and husband Jeff, all of Olmstead; his brother, Johnny Shackelford and wife Debbie of Olmstead; his sisters, Carolyn Coleman and husband Roger of Adairville and Dorothy Carter and husband Ray of Smiths Grove; eight grandchildren, twenty great-grandchildren and two great-great-grandchildren.
